What you can expect to do here:

  • As an Associate Archaeologist on our team you will:
  • Assist with the implementation of archaeology projects with a major focus on data collection and processing and an introduction to or increasing role in analysis and interpretation in a professional cultural resource management setting
  • Utilize field skills to supervise or assist with archaeological excavation and survey work in a variety of field conditions with overnight stays when working on out-of-town projects
  • Have an increasing role in artifact cataloguing and analysis
  • Contribute to the preparation of reports through research and writing assigned sections
  • Contribute to sections of proposals
  • Maintain a high standard of ethical and professional behavior to uphold WSP's reputation and demonstrate a commitment to our Destination Culture
  • Demonstrate a "Safety First" focus and act as a role model to other staff


What you'll bring to WSP:

  • Bachelor's degree in Archaeology, Anthropology, or related discipline from a recognized program
  • 3-5 years archaeological work experience or related work experience
  • At least 1 field season of experience supervising a field team of at least 4 people
  • A valid archaeological license in Ontario (Research or Professional)
  • A valid driver's licence and access to a vehicle
  • Experience writing technical archaeological reports
  • The ability and willingness to observe and practice good field methodology at a brisk pace and to work outdoors in variable terrain and weather conditions
  • Knowledge of Ontario material culture and ability to identify artifacts in the field
  • Knowledge and understanding of Ontario Standards and Guidelines for Consulting Archaeologists
  • Experience working with Indigenous communities considered an asset
